Special Olympics Athletes Visiting The Northern Trust - Player Transportation Helping Out



Wednesday (8/22), Pro-Am Day at The Northern Trust, was also a special day for multiple Special Olympics golfers.  The whole afternoon was set aside to allow the athletes to experience the Ridgewood Country Club clubhouse, practice on the range and tee off to play a few holes. Of course, the obligatory 1st Tee photo was taken and later on, during the evening reception handed to the players and their families. The tournament's Player Transportation committee helped, as usual, with shuttling the golfers and families between the hotel and the clubhouse.

Special treat for The Northern Trust Player Transportation Volunteers




The volunteers in the Player Transportation committee at The Northern Trust received a special 'THANK YOU' from a happy 'customer'. Gestures like this are rare, so this makes it even more special.

Yesterday (Tuesday), one day after the main arrival rush was behind us, the manager of Louis Oosthuizen stopped by our transportation office and dropped off 3 boxes of donuts for our deserving volunteers. That was such a nice THANK YOU for the hard work the volunteer drivers in our committee accomplished over the weekend.   On arrival weekend for the tournament (Sat - Mon) alone, already over 200 trips were completed.

2018/2019 PGA TOUR schedule announced

Finally, the 2018/2019 PGA TOUR schedule has been announced today (7/10/2018). There are quite some interesting changes:
First of all, the number of FedExCup playoff tournaments has been reduced from previously 4 to now 3. The order will be:
  1. THE NORTHERN TRUST (being played in Boston every other year, starting 2020) with 125 players.
  2. BMW Championship with 70 players.
  3. TOUR Championship with 30 players.

Starting with the 2019/2020 PGA TOUR season, The Houston Open as well as the 'A Military Tribute at The Greenbrier' will move into the fall as early tournaments in the wrap-around season.
